Big ticket giveaway part of Cathay Pacific celebrations for centenary of powered flight in Hong Kong

Cathay Pacific Airways today announced that it will launch four major initiatives to tie in with Hong Kong Civil Aviation Department-led celebrations to mark the 100th anniversary of aviation development in Hong Kong.

The airline will be giving away 1,800 free tickets to the Hong Kong public, inviting them to submit their thoughts on how air transport connects their home city with the world, and will also launch a special fare promotion covering more than 20 destinations with fares as low as HK$990. In addition, the carrier will run an aviation knowledge contest for students in Hong Kong, offering a unique delivery flight trip as a reward, and a special 100th Anniversary logo will go onto one of Cathay Pacific’s passenger aircraft.

Cathay Pacific Chief Executive Tony Tyler unveiled the special activities today together with officiating guests Ms Florence Hui, Under Secretary for Home Affairs, and Mr Norman Lo, Director-General Civil Aviation.

Speaking at the press launch, Mr Tyler said: “Over the past 64 years, Cathay Pacific has played an important role in the growth of Hong Kong's aviation industry, and we are proud to launch these four initiatives to celebrate this important milestone in the city’s aviation development. As Hong Kong’s home carrier, Cathay Pacific is committed to the continued development of Hong Kong as one of the world’s leading aviation hubs, and we are pleased to be able to share in the anniversary celebrations with the public and our passengers.”

Under Secretary for Home Affairs Florence Hui said “We are honoured to support Cathay Pacific in organising the 'Connecting Your World' campaign, which is being run as part of our own 'Get into Discovery' campaign.’Get into Discovery' is one of the four core elements of the 'Vibrant People, Harmonious Community Activities' programme launched by the Home Affairs Bureau and the Home Affairs Department. We need to work with other organisations to sustain the momentum of this programme and we are happy to have Cathay Pacific as our valuable partner.”

Director-General Civil Aviation Norman Lo said "We have the best airlines, the best airport, outstanding aircraft maintenance organisations and a very safe and efficient air traffic management system. These achievements should be attributed to our bold predecessors and every hard-working individuals serving in the industry. We are very grateful that Cathay Pacific gives their unfailing support to the organising of the celebratory programmes. The special campaign initiated by Cathay Pacific proves its commitment and dedication in serving Hong Kong's community." To mark Hong Kong’s aviation anniversary, Cathay Pacific is joining with sister airline Dragonair to launch one of the biggest fare promotions in town, covering more than 20 favourite regional and long-haul destinations. The two airlines have allocated 50,000 round-trip tickets for this promotion, which will run from 5 March to 11 March, with the lowest fares starting at just HK$990. Booking and fare details will be available at www.cathaypacific.com and www.dragonair.com from midnight on 4 March. Every 100th passenger making a booking through these websites will win cash vouchers equivalent in value to the airfare purchased to redeem for their next flight.

Cathay Pacific is launching the “Connecting Your World” competition as part of the Home Affairs Department’s ongoing “Get Into Discovery” campaign, giving away 1,800 tickets to the Hong Kong public. The competition will be organized on a district basis and entries can be submitted online starting in April. The competition is open to all Hong Kong residents aged 16 and above. Participants can submit their entries online in video, photo, graphic illustration or written form on the subject of how air transport connects Hong Kong with the world, from the basic necessities of life to job creation, business opportunities, and building a bridge between people, places and cultures.

One-hundred tickets will be given out to residents of each of Hong Kong’s 18 districts. Each district will select the best 50 entries with a panel of judges made up of District Council representatives, a creative professional and a Cathay Pacific representative. The Champion in each district will win two Economy Class return tickets to any long-haul destination served by Cathay Pacific. The other 49 winners from each district will each get two Economy Class return tickets to any of the airline’s regional destinations. In total, 900 winners will be selected from the 18 districts, each getting two return tickets. More details on how to enter the “Connecting Your World” competition will be announced soon.

The Cathay Pacific Aviation Knowledge Contest is being jointly organised with the Hong Kong Civil Aviation Department and the Hong Kong Air Cadet Corps for all local secondary school students in Hong Kong. From 5 March, the public will be engaged through a special Facebook page, www.facebook.com/100cxcontest, featuring fun quizzes and games. In July, teams from local secondary schools will compete against each other in a live aviation quiz, with the winning team being flown to either the Airbus factory in France or the Boeing factory in the United States to join the delivery of a brand-new aircraft. Details of the contest will be made available on the Facebook page.

Finally, Cathay Pacific will show its commitment to honouring Hong Kong’s aviation anniversary by placing a specially designed commemorative logo by Civil Aviation Department on one of its Boeing 747-400 aircraft. The same aircraft will be used in one of the major events being organised by the Civil Aviation Department to mark the centenary – the Aircraft Pull on 17 March where more than 300 pullers will aim to break a Guinness World Record by manually pulling four aircraft simultaneously. This special Jumbo will fly on Cathay Pacific’s long haul routes and help carry the celebration to other parts of the world.

The Civil Aviation Department is organizing a series of activities to celebrate the centenary of aviation development in Hong Kong with the help of aviation-related partners. Events include a photo exhibition at Hong Kong International Airport, the Aircraft Pull, a charity gala dinner, aviation career talks and visits, and the Cathay Pacific Aviation Knowledge Contest. Various commemorative items such as special stamps and souvenirs will be also issued.

國泰送逾千機票/五萬特惠機票 賀香港動力飛行百周年

國泰航空今天公布四項與民同樂的活動,與民航處齊賀香港動力飛行百周年。

國泰公布的4項活動內容如下:

1. 推出超過20個航點的特惠機票,票價低至990港元

2. 送出1,800張免費機票,請全港市民就航空業如何連繫香港至世界為主題提交創作

3. 舉辦中學生飛行常識大賽,勝出隊伍可參與國泰到法國或美國飛機廠接收新飛機的特別旅程

4. 在一架國泰客機上,印上民航處香港動力飛行百周年的特別紀念標誌

國泰今天為上述活動揭幕,行政總裁湯彥麟連同民政事務局許曉暉副局長及民航處羅崇文處長主禮。

湯彥麟表示:「國泰於過去64年在香港航空業發展擔當重要角色。今天很榮幸能舉辦這4項活動,以紀念這重要的里程碑。作為香港的本土航空公司,國泰一直致力鞏固香港作為國際主要航空樞紐的地位,很高興能與香港市民及我們的乘客共同參與這百周年盛事。」

民政事務局副局長許曉暉表示:「我們全力支持國泰舉辦『飛常連繫』比賽,送出1,800張機票作為『活出逍遙』計劃的一部分。『活出逍遙』是民政事務局和民政事務總署合辦『繽Fun融和社區活動』計劃的4個核心元素之一。我們一直與不同夥伴合作,讓計劃得以延續。很高興是次能與國泰航空合作推廣有關計劃。」

民航處處長羅崇文表示:「香港航空業今天擁有最佳航空公司、最佳機場、卓越的飛機維修服務機構,以及非常安全及高效率的航空交通管理系統,這都是業界前輩勇於創新及努力不懈的成果。非常感謝國泰航空對我們舉辦紀念活動一直給予大力支持,而所舉辦的特別慶祝活動亦反映國泰積極服務香港社群的精神。」

為紀念香港動力飛行百周年,國泰聯同姊妹公司港龍航空,由3月5日至11日舉辦大型機票特惠活動,推出50,000張超過20個區內及長線旅遊熱點的特惠來回機票,票價低至990港元。機票預訂及票價詳情將於3月5日凌晨起上載於www.cathaypacific.com 及 www.dragonair.com網站,而於上述網站預訂機票的每第100位乘客,更可獲贈所訂機票的等額現金券,用作將來購買國泰或港龍機票之用。

為配合民政事務總署舉辦的「活出逍遙」計劃,國泰將推出「飛常連繫」網上比賽作為計劃的一部分,送出1,800張機票。比賽以分區形式進行,年滿16歲的香港居民,可以航空業連繫香港至世界各地為主題,創作短片、相片、畫作或文章等,以表達航空業如何從基本生活所需、製造就業機會及商機,以至連繫人、地及文化等各方面,成為香港與世界接軌的橋樑。作品可於4月起在網上提交。

全港18區每區會獲分配100張免費機票作為獎品。由區議會代表、專業創作人及國泰代表組成的評審團,從每區選出50位優勝者,每區冠軍可贏得兩張前往國泰旗下任何一個長線航點的來回經濟客位機票,而每區其餘49位優勝者,則可獲得兩張前往國泰旗下任何一個區內航點的來回經濟客位機票。參加辦法即將公布。

另外,國泰亦與香港民航處及香港航空青年團合辦「飛行常識大賽」,歡迎全港中學生參加。在3月5日起的大賽首階段,主辦單位會透過Facebook網站www.facebook.com/100cxcontest定期舉行飛行常識小測驗和有趣活動。至7月便會邀請中學生組隊參加大型問答比賽,決鬥一番。問答比賽總冠軍隊伍可參與國泰航空到法國空中巴士飛機廠或美國波音飛機廠接收新飛機,比賽詳情會透過Facebook網頁公布。

為隆重其事,國泰會為旗下一架波音747-400飛機印上民航處香港動力飛行百周年的特別紀念標誌。該飛機會在3月17日作為民航處舉辦「拉飛機」活動的其中一員,屆時超過300位參加者會嘗試同時拉動4架飛機,以打破健力士世界紀錄,而該架印上百周年紀念標誌的珍寶客機,會飛行國泰長途航線,與各地旅客分享慶典的喜悅。

為慶祝香港動力飛行百周年,民航處率領同業界夥伴舉辦連串誌慶活動,包括香港國際機場相片展覽、拉飛機、慈善籌款晚宴、航空就業講座及參觀。國泰航空飛行常識大賽等,並會發行紀念品如郵票小型張及精品。
